#e8d2d2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e8d2d2 is composed of 91% red, 82.4%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 9.5% magenta, 9.5% yellow and 9% black. It has a hue angle of 0 degrees, a saturation of 32.4% and a lightness of 86.7%. #e8d2d2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#d1a5a5. Closest websafe color is: #ffcccc.

● #e8d2d2 color description : Light grayish red.
#e8d2d2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e8d2d2 has RGB values of R:232, G:210, B:210 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.09, Y:0.09, K:0.09. Its decimal value is 15258322.
